Acesso a arquivos e diretórios¶
Os módulos descritos neste capítulo dizem respeito aos arquivos e diretórios no disco. Por exemplo, existem módulos para ler as propriedades dos arquivos, manipular o caminhos de forma multiplataforma e para criar arquivos temporários. A lista completa de módulos neste capítulo é:
pathlib
— Caminhos do sistema de arquivos orientados a objetosos.path
— Manipulações comuns de nomes de caminhosstat
— Interpretando resultados destat()
filecmp
— File and Directory Comparisonstempfile
— Generate temporary files and directoriesglob
— Expansão de padrão de nome de arquivo no estilo Unixfnmatch
— Correspondência de padrões de nome de arquivo Unixlinecache
— Acesso aleatório a linhas de textoshutil
— Operações de arquivo de alto nível
Ver também
- Módulo
os
Interfaces do sistema operacional, incluindo funções para trabalhar com arquivos num nível inferior a objetos arquivos do Python.
- Módulo
io
A biblioteca embutida de E/S do Python, incluindo as classes abstratas e algumas classes concretas, como E/S de arquivos.
- Função embutida
open()
A maneira padrão de abrir arquivos para ler e escrever em Python.